Pinterest Intros AI-Powered Recommendations

As Pinterest attempts to solve its “AI Slop” problem, the company is attempting to boost its in-app shopping presence ahead of the holiday season with new in-feed, AI-powered product recommendations.

In a blog post, Pinterest describes its “Boards made for you” feature as “personalized boards curated using a combination of editorial expertise and AI-powered recommendations.”

The feature is designed to deliver shoppable content directly to users' home feeds and inboxes. If a user is interested in clothing, for example, they might receive content including trending styles and weekly outfit inspiration, which will showcase items for purchase.

Over the next few months, Pinterest users in the U.S. and Canada will begin to see their in-app boards change with the inclusion of new tabs focused on personalized, seamless shopping.

These will include a “Make it yours” tab recommending products and content dedicated to fashion and home decor boards, as well as a “More ideas” tab, which will provide recommended related Pins for all other board categories, such as beauty, recipes, and art.

Pinterest also writes that in the “All saves” tab, users can find all of the previously saved Pins their updated boards are partly based on.

In addition, in the U.S. and Canada, Pinterest is currently experimenting with “Styled for you” AI-powered collages, devised from fashion Pins that users have saved to their boards.

“Pinterest users can mix-and-match different fashion apparel and accessories” to create and shop outfits based on their personal taste, the company says.

With the introduction of AI-powered boards and collages, Pinterest is attempting to get more out of saved Pins, expanding and evolving its recommendations algorithm.
